ADC K-9 GRADUATION

 

May 8, 2008  

The Arizona Department of Corrections continues to fulfill its commitment to sustaining public safety now, and later.   In December, Service Dog Academy Class 26-58 graduated 15 service dogs and their handlers, including 11 ADC teams, from the nationally accredited training course at the Correctional Officers Training Academy in Tucson.  Twice yearly, COTA hosts a nine-week K-9 academy, training dual purpose canines (drug detection and handler protection) and Officer Handlers for the ADC, Sheriff and Police agencies from all over Arizona.  ADC Service Dog program administrator Roger Pendergast, ASPC-Tucson Warden Greg Fizer, Senior Dog Handler/Trainer Kenny Vance and Senior Dog Handler/Trainer Lt. Steven Lowe presented graduation certificates to the officers and their new partners.
